President Emomali Rahmon Expresses Condolences over the Death of poet Mehmon Bakhti
Read also
DUSHANBE, 20.05.2022 (NIAT Khovar) – President of Tajikistan Emomali Rahmon expressed his deep condolences to the family and friends of the People’s Poet of Tajikistan and recipient of the State Prize of Tajikistan named after Abuabdullo Rudaki Mehmon Bakhti.
The message reads:
“Mehmon Bakhti has made a great contribution to the development of modern Tajik literature and drama, for many years he served as the chairman of the Tajik Writers’ Union; he was a member of the National Assembly, served as a deputy of the Assembly of Representatives, and deputy chairman of the Movement for National Unity and Revival of Tajikistan. His works are very popular among the people of Tajikistan.
The good name, patriotic and humane works of Mehmon Bakhti will forever remain in the memory of the people.”
Today, People’s Poet of Tajikistan Mehmon Bakhti passed away at the age of 81.
